The process&nbsp; of printing&nbsp; words on watermark paper is a special kind of&nbsp; printing through which an exclusive feature can be added onto paper. In&nbsp; the case of watermark paper, when you hold it up to the light, this is a faint design or logo visible within&nbsp; its surface. This design is formed during&nbsp; the process of paper-making, not added after. Think also about the color of your paper. Watermarks are shown a bit differently when you change background color. Lighter shades can enhance the watermark and help it pop, whereas darker hues can offer a more sophisticated edge.
